UNS Energy Corporation, headquartered in Tucson, Arizona, is a subsidiary of Fortis Inc., the largest investor-owned electric and gas distribution utility in Canada. Our public utility subsidiaries, Tucson Electric Power Company, UNS Electric, Inc. and UNS Gas, Inc., power our economy by providing electric and gas service to nearly 700,000 customers in Arizona.

We embrace a spirit of giving, dedicated to improving quality of life in the communities we have served for generations, and in TEP's case, since the 1890s. We're building a cleaner, greener grid, with more wind and solar power than ever before, while maintaining safe, reliable, and affordable service.

Job Description - Director, Environmental Compliance and Policy

Position Description

Directs the activities of UNS Energy's Environmental Services Compliance Team and maintains collaborative leadership on policy advocacy. Primary responsibility for supporting and enhancing the UNS Energy Environmental Compliance Program, to maintain compliance with all environmental regulations and policies (including air, water, land use and waste), and for driving Company strategy and advocacy on environmental and energy policy matters. This position ensures the comprehensive due diligence efforts for environmental permitting and other considerations for new development opportunities. Cross-department collaboration, as well as exemplifying/building UNS Energy's positive, values driven culture are fundamental to this role.

Position-Related Responsibilities

Environmental Compliance

* Supervises the day-to-day operation of the Environmental Services Compliance Team and oversees budgeting, staffing and workload.

* Ensures and staffs the timely and accurate certification and submittal of all environmental permit applications, reports and submittals.

* Accountable for and oversees the UNS Energy Environmental Compliance Program and directs the Company's air, waste, and water quality programs to maintain compliance with federal, state and local regulations.

* Maintains shared responsibility for environmental and energy policy efforts.

* Represents the Company in legislative and regulatory hearings and workshops dealing with new rule-making activities and leads the development of written and/or oral comments to federal and/or state regulatory agencies concerning proposed rule-making activities that affect Company interests.

* Provides technical consulting/advice to Operations personnel concerning environmental regulation impact on operations.

* Supervises the Energy Resources (Field) and Corporate Environmental Services compliance teams. Ensures the integration, collaboration and cross-function of field and corporate efforts and further builds communication and relationship between Environmental Services and Operations.

* Supports and informs the Company's climate adaptation (e.g. resiliency) and mitigation (e.g. carbon reduction) efforts, working closely with Executive Leadership and the Environmental Services Sustainability Team.

* Responsible for informing/fact-checking external reporting of environmental and related sustainability matters.

* Supports development and implementation of the Company's Integrated Resource Plans, by advising on environmental regulatory impacts and analyzing environmental compliance considerations.

* Coordinates across departments on environmental compliance, policy and strategy matters. Collaborates on outreach efforts.

* Responsible for environmental due diligence and strategy recommendations for new development projects, as well as environmental permitting and staff support and implementation for the continued operation of new projects.

* Responsible for identification and mitigation of environmental risks.

* Co-Chairs internal committees focused on environmental matters.

Knowledge, Skills & Abilities

(Equivalent combination of education and experience will be considered.)

* Degree in engineering, environmental, legal or project / business management or related field.

* At least 10 years of experience with environmental or energy policy, environmental compliance or regulation and sustainability or equivalent combination of education and experience. Experience must include supervisory responsibility.

* Must have the ability to understand and provide a simple interpretation of complex rules and regulations, ideally those that relate to vertically integrated electric utility business, environmental or sustainability programs.

* Strong organizational and leadership skills.

* Must have the ability to build and maintain strong relationships across all Company departments.

* Demonstrated experience in leading cross-functional teams to achieve desired results.

* Excellent oral and written communication and problem identification and conflict resolution skills.

Pay Rate: $160,000 - $200,000+ depending on experience
